Father is arrested for raping daughters aged 7 and 8 in front of 10-year-old son in Paraná

A 46-year-old man from Cascavel, located in western Paraná, has been arrested for allegedly raping his two daughters, aged 7 and 8, in front of their 10-year-old brother. The suspect, whose identity has not been disclosed, is accused of committing these heinous acts repeatedly within the family home. This shocking case has drawn attention due to its horrific nature, highlighting issues of child abuse and family safety in Brazil.

According to statements from the Paraná Civil Police (PCPR), the alleged abuses took place during the period from December 2025 to January 2026, while the children were under their father's care. It was confirmed that some of the incidents were witnessed by the boy, which adds another layer of trauma to an already traumatic situation. The police gathered substantial evidence supporting the claims, leading to the decision by the judicial system to enact preventive detention of the father to ensure the safety of the children and the public.

In the course of the arrest, law enforcement officials also executed a search warrant at the suspect's residence, where they seized electronic devices that will undergo forensic examination.
